I don't think any of the developers use Gadu-Gadu (or even really know how it's supposed to work), so this is kind of hard for us to look at. How does this work in Pidgin? Do you have to manually click on a button or something to download the buddy list? Or is it expected to just be downloaded the first time you connect and that's not working?
*** Original post on bio 37 by Paweł Masarczyk <pawelmasarczyk AT gmail.com> at 2012-08-13 06:38:58 UTC *** Good morning! In Pidgin there's a button for manual requesting of the contact list retrieval. once clicked it pulls the list from the server and imports it to the local DB of Pidgin. In addition there's also an export button for manual pushing of any changes to the list to the GG servers for Back Up purposes. I hope it helps. Thanks in advance. Have a nice day. Paweł
*** Original post on bio 37 at 2012-08-13 12:45:59 UTC *** (In reply to comment #10) > In Pidgin there's a button for manual requesting of the contact list retrieval. > once clicked it pulls the list from the server and imports it to the local DB > of Pidgin. In addition there's also an export button for manual pushing of any > changes to the list to the GG servers for Back Up purposes. It looks like this will be fixed in libpurple 3.0.0 [1] with automatic synchronization of the buddy list. [1] http://developer.pidgin.im/ticket/9463
